Back EVA - A soft, adhesive layer used to encapsulate solar cells from the back side (beneath the cells). It is thermally bonded during lamination to keep cells in place and protect them.
Back Sheet - The outermost rear layer of a solar panel, usually made of multi-layered polymer material. It is the last protective layer on the back side of the module, visible externally
